Social media has become an indispensable communication channel in civilian society, and the military sector is no different. It can be used as a platform for information and recruitment purposes, fulfil a welfare function for personnel keeping in touch with family and friends, and as a strategic communication tool for opinion-forming and psychological operations. Social media offers fast, direct, and wide-reaching communications, so it is critical that public affairs professionals are properly equipped to make the most of what  social media has to offer.
